A report has recently been released by the Oklahoma Climatological Survey predicting that as a result of climate change, droughts in Oklahoma will increase in frequency and severity. As a result, there is a discussion going on among the producers-members of the Oklahoma Food Coop over mitigation strategies. One issue that has come up is "conserving water in ponds", presumably by reducing evaporation.

Any thoughts about that? Would aquatic plants that cover the surface of the water help?
